In this episode of The Crash, we dive deep into the timeless parable of The Prodigal Son. Join us as we explore the rich cultural context and historical nuances often overlooked in modern interpretations. We'll revisit the significance of family dynamics, societal expectations, and the concept of Honor-Shame in ancient times, shedding light on how these elements enhance our understanding of this incredible passage.
